J'ai Myactivity qui obtient les données d'intention de la première activité. Les données d'intention sont envoyées via un spinner de l'activité. Je veux enregistrer ces données d'intention du spinner à Myactvity. les données d'intention doivent persister lorsque j'entre dans l'option de menu Myactivity par l'activité suivante.comment enregistrer les données d'intention transmises de la première activité à la deuxième activité
0
A
Répondre
3
dans votre premier Activité1
Intent myintent= new Intent(FirstActivity.this,SecondActivity.class);
myintent.putExtra("Name", "your String");
startActivity(myintent);
dans Second Activity2
Intent myintent = getIntent();
if(null!=myintent.getExtras()){
String Name= myintent.getExtras().getString("Name");
Toast.makeText(getApplicationContext(),""+Name,12).show();
}else{
Toast.makeText(getApplicationContext(),"No Recor Here..",12).show();
}
comme SharedPreferences [2] dans votre premier ActivityA
Intent myintent= new Intent(FirstActivity.this,SecondActivity.class);
SharedPreferences spref = this.getSharedPreferences("mynotifyid", MODE_WORLD_WRITEABLE);
SharedPreferences.Editor spreedit = spref.edit();
spreedit.putString("Name1", str1.toString());
spreedit.putString("Name2", str2.toString());
spreedit.putString("Name3", str3.toString());
spreedit.putString("Name4", str4.toString());
spreedit.commit();
startActivity(myintent);
dans votre deuxième ActivityB
SharedPreferences spref = context.getSharedPreferences("mynotifyid", Context.MODE_WORLD_WRITEABLE);
String str1 = spref.getString("Name1","");
String str2 = spref.getString("Name2","");
String str3 = spref.getString("Name3","");
String str4 = spref.getString("Name4","");
pour votre objectif de sauvegarde objet SharedPreferences
Questions connexes
- 1. Comment enregistrer les données dans mon ListView de la première activité à la deuxième activité?
- 2. activité première est recréait quand setResult() Retour à la première activité de la deuxième activité
- 3. comment enregistrer le résultat sur la première activité de la deuxième activité?
- 4. Deuxième activité me renvoie à la première activité dans Android
- 5. Commencer la deuxième activité après avoir terminé la première activité
- 6. comment puis-je sauvegarder les données que j'ai transmises de la deuxième activité à l'activité principale?
- 7. comment pouvons-nous envoyer des données de la première activité à la seconde activité et deuxième activité à première activité bu en utilisant l'intention
- 8. Tab en deuxième activité remplacer onglet dans la première activité
- 9. Comment ouvrir une activité, entrer des données et revenir à la première activité avec les données?
- 10. Comment passer l'emplacement actuel de la deuxième activité à la première activité dans android
- 11. appel Deuxième activité de première activité dans Android
- 12. La troisième activité appelée renvoie son résultat à la première activité au lieu d'envoyer le résultat à la deuxième activité?
- 13. Comment définir une image dans une deuxième activité à partir de la première activité?
- 14. comment une partie de la deuxième activité est visible dans la première activité dans android
- 15. Android: Actualiser la listeAfficher dans la première activité au retour de la deuxième activité
- 16. comment faire pour recevoir la deuxième activité
- 17. Obtenir les données de la première activité à la quatrième activité dans android
- 18. Sur le dos de la deuxième activité, la première activité est vide
- 19. Je ne peux pas reprendre la première activité après la rotation dans la deuxième activité
- 20. Activité principale à la deuxième activité et de la deuxième activité à l'activité principale par le bouton
- 21. Asynctask égal à zéro lors de la modification de la deuxième activité et de la première activité de retour
- 22. Mon application s'arrête après la première activité. Il devrait passer à la deuxième puis à la troisième activité
- 23. Démarrage lent de la deuxième activité
- 24. Comment enregistrer la dernière position d'article de RecyclerView quand revenir de la deuxième activité à la première activité en utilisant l'intention
- 25. Transmettre la valeur de la première activité à la troisième activité via AsyncTask
- 26. Démarrer l'application avec la deuxième activité
- 27. comment obtenir de la valeur dans edittext dans une activité de la deuxième activité?
- 28. vérifier radioButton sélectionné de la deuxième activité
- 29. Activité ne conserve pas les informations transmises android
- 30. info de la 1ère activité à une quatrième activité
Le code peut-il utiliser la préférence partagée? Au lieu de toast comment utiliser la préférence partagée pour la persistance des données d'intention? – user1611632